38 weeks pregnant with twins - Gemma's Story
After unsuccessfully trying for a baby, my husband and I went through IVF. Our first attempt failed, and we were devastated. We thought that we would never be parents.
However, luckily for us, we had opted to freeze any unused embryos, so that we would not have to go through the whole process again. We had 2 embryos left, and both were implanted. To say that we were thrilled when we discovered they had taken is an understatement!
We went for our first ultrasound 5 weeks into the pregnancy, and as we looked at the image on the screen, we could see two small black 'blobs'. I asked the nurse if that meant there were two babies, and she casually said 'oh yes, that's twins!' We were speechless! However, we were over the moon - to go from thinking that we would never be parents, to having two babies was the best news ever!
They grew rapidly! I seemed to get bigger and bigger and from about 6 months, I already measured the equivalent of a full term single pregnancy! I became so uncomfortable, that I just wanted to have them. My husband kept telling me that the longer they stayed inside me, the healthier they would be. We fully expected to have them early, and were told by our OB that I needed to make it to at least 32 weeks.
However, I ended up having to schedule my C-Section (I wanted them vaginally, but one was breech and the other was transverse), and they were born at 38 weeks 1 day. I really did go to full term, and even my OB was surprised that I lasted as long as I did! I was huge!
Emma was born at 10.41 am and weighed in at 6 lbs 13 oz. Caitlyn was born at 10.43 am and weighed in at 6 lbs 4 oz.
I was very lucky and the baby weight dropped off - I lost all of my weight and was back into my jeans in 2 weeks! I gained about 50 lbs during my pregnancy.
There is no denying that being a mother to twins is hard work, but they are worth every minute. Even when they don't sleep at night, I look into their beautiful faces and my heart just melts.
